Defending the Gate - 2013
Defending the Gate is the usual kickoff event for the war season. Some years it is cold, others it is wet, but this year it was gorgeous! Also, the gate was bigger and better than ever before. No more flimsy walls, this construction was really four gates in one and we fought all around it. The event was well attended and the fighting started relatively on time, which is a blessing at the first event of the year. We teamed up with Bright Hills, and though outnumbered carried much of the day. Galatia won unit of the day, which sadly did not come with any booty. Titus was also awarded one of the three fighter of the day awards, which did come with some booty. Huzzah. A great day was had by all.
